The 2026 ASPM Buyer’s Guide: The Shift to AI-Native Application Security
Download the Guide
This guide details the transition from traditional, aggregation-focused Application Security Posture Management (ASPM) to an AI-native architecture. It argues that the speed of AI-assisted development requires a platform that can actively validate theoretical vulnerabilities against real-world runtime exposure.
